My Samsung Omnia's touch screen somehow malfunctioned. It just started pressing itself Randomly, more especially the bottom left corner of the screen, Phone button when on home screen. What might

does your phone have the unresponsive touch screen? if it occurs, try this. Take your fingernail and run it along the screen and the plastic housing. Push hard as you do it, and it will free up the screen. This has happened to me as well. and my phone's working now. this was a solution given by mephisto250 on youtube. :)

Samsung F700V shortcut display problems

Hm, this is a difficult one. I have a F700 and there is no option for it to auto lock on slide closure. U might have a different firmware so look around the settings for it. Disable it if you can find it.

This might also sound stupid but make sure the lock key on the right hand side has been slid up. Slid down locks touchscreen.
